Poppy Bridgerton was visiting a friend to keep her occupied while her husband was away. One afternoon, Poppy decided to take a walk along the beach while her friend napped. She happened upon a cave and decided to explore. Unfortunately, the cave was being used by privateers to store goods. Because she found their hideout, they took her back to their ship. They didn’t want to have their hideout reported to the authorities. Poppy soon found herself aboard a ship bound for Lisbon, Portugal.
Captain Andrew James hoped he would be able to complete his mission in Lisbon quickly and return back to England to bring the lady back to her home. He was very glad that their lives had not crossed before the events leading her to the confinement on his ship. Captain James was really Andrew James Rokesby and was distantly related to Poppy by marriage. He was secretly working for the British government carrying important documents back and forth to emissaries in foreign countries. As the ship was currently fully staffed, there was no other room for Poppy to use during the voyage. Andrew and Poppy would have to share the Captain’s Quarters and make do the best they could.
I enjoyed reading Poppy and Andrew’s story. Poppy was determined and knew what she wanted in life. I love a regency novel where the heroine is not the run of the mill miss looking for anyone to take her off of the marriage mart. Andrew was a kind and thoughtful hero who was concerned for everyone aboard his ship. Both cared deeply for their families and had much in common. As expected, their time in close proximity led to romance. I enjoyed meeting other characters I had met in previous books. There is one more book in this series and I look forward to reconnecting with the Bridgertons/Rokesbys soon.
